What these times mean
Solar times in Belle Glade shift throughout the year. Each stage of the day brings distinct light that photographers, outdoor planners, and everyday users rely on.
- Dawn
- The first usable twilight before sunrise, when the horizon brightens and color gradually returns to the sky.
- Sunrise
- The moment the upper edge of the sun appears above the horizon, starting direct daylight.
- Golden Hour
- The low-angle window just after sunrise and just before sunset, producing warm, soft light favored by photographers.
- Sunset
- The moment the upper edge of the sun drops below the horizon, ending direct sunlight for the day.
- Dusk
- The fading twilight after sunset, ending with astronomical dusk when the sky becomes fully dark.
Monthly daylight in Belle Glade
Sunrise, sunset, and total daylight in Belle Glade on the 15th of each month for 2026. Times reflect the city's local timezone.
| Month | Sunrise | Sunset | Daylight |
|---|---|---|---|
| January | 7:12 AM | 5:51 PM | 10h 39m |
| February | 6:58 AM | 6:15 PM | 11h 16m |
| March | 7:31 AM | 7:31 PM | 12h 00m |
| April | 6:58 AM | 7:46 PM | 12h 48m |
| May | 6:35 AM | 8:03 PM | 13h 28m |
| June | 6:28 AM | 8:17 PM | 13h 49m |
| July | 6:38 AM | 8:18 PM | 13h 39m |
| August | 6:54 AM | 7:59 PM | 13h 05m |
| September | 7:08 AM | 7:26 PM | 12h 19m |
| October | 7:22 AM | 6:54 PM | 11h 32m |
| November | 6:42 AM | 5:32 PM | 10h 50m |
| December | 7:03 AM | 5:32 PM | 10h 29m |
